Web31 jul. 2024 · When you say the time in Italian, it’s more common to use the twelve-hour clock, unless it’s in written official communication. In order to avoid confusion or ambiguity, you’ll often hear Italians say the time with the twelve-hour clock, adding di mattina, del pomeriggio, di sera, or di notte (“in the morning, in the afternoon, in the evening, at night”). Web25 mrt. 2024 · “ Happy new year ” in Italian is ” Buon anno nuovo “. But there are variations you can use: Felice anno nuovo! – Happy New Year Tanti auguri di buon anno! – Many wishes for a good year! Buon anno – Happy New Year Ti auguro un buon anno nuovo – I wish you a Happy New Year

Web21 jun. 2024 · Let’s learn the Italian words and phrases for summer! In Italy, summer always begins with the celebrations for San Giovanni Battista (Saint John the Baptist). San Giovanni falls on June 24th and being the patron saint of quite a number of Italian cities, it means feast and parties most everywhere. In certain places, the celebration takes ...
